FPGA工程师与硬件工程师在个人成长方面的区别
在当今快速发展的电子技术领域,FPGA工程师与硬件工程师的角色日益凸显。两者在技术领域有着密切的联系,但个人成长方面却存在诸多差异。本文将深入探讨FPGA工程师与硬件工程师在个人成长方面的区别,旨在为从事相关职业的人员提供参考。
FPGA工程师的成长之路
FPGA工程师主要负责设计、开发、测试和优化FPGA(现场可编程门阵列)相关产品。FPGA工程师的个人成长主要表现在以下几个方面:
技术深度:FPGA工程师需要具备扎实的数字电路设计基础,熟练掌握Verilog、VHDL等硬件描述语言,熟悉FPGA的架构和编程方法。随着经验的积累,工程师需要不断学习新的FPGA技术和应用领域,提高自己的技术深度。
项目经验:FPGA工程师在项目实践中不断积累经验,从需求分析、方案设计、硬件调试到系统测试,每个环节都需要细心操作。通过参与多个项目,工程师可以提升自己的项目管理能力和团队协作能力。
创新能力:FPGA技术具有高度灵活性,工程师需要具备创新思维,不断探索新的应用领域。例如,将FPGA应用于人工智能、物联网等领域,为行业发展注入新的活力。
硬件工程师的成长之路
硬件工程师主要负责设计、开发、测试和优化硬件产品。硬件工程师的个人成长主要表现在以下几个方面:
电路设计能力:硬件工程师需要具备扎实的模拟电路和数字电路设计基础,熟练掌握各种电路设计工具,如Altium Designer、Cadence等。此外,还需要了解各种元器件的特性,掌握PCB设计规范。
系统级设计:硬件工程师需要具备系统级设计能力,能够从整体上考虑产品的性能、成本、功耗等因素。在项目实践中,工程师需要不断优化设计方案,提高产品的竞争力。
跨学科知识:硬件工程师需要具备一定的跨学科知识,如电磁场、信号处理、机械设计等。这些知识有助于工程师更好地理解产品需求,提高设计质量。
FPGA工程师与硬件工程师在个人成长方面的区别
技术领域:FPGA工程师专注于FPGA技术,而硬件工程师则涉及更广泛的硬件领域。FPGA工程师需要深入学习FPGA的架构、编程方法、应用领域等,而硬件工程师则需要掌握电路设计、系统级设计、跨学科知识等。
职业发展:FPGA工程师在FPGA领域具有较高的技术门槛,职业发展路径相对较窄。硬件工程师则拥有更广阔的职业发展空间,可以从事电路设计、系统级设计、项目管理等工作。
团队协作:FPGA工程师在项目实践中需要与软件工程师、测试工程师等密切合作,而硬件工程师则需要与机械工程师、软件工程师、测试工程师等多学科人员协作。
案例分析
以智能摄像头为例,FPGA工程师主要负责设计视频处理模块,利用FPGA的高性能处理能力实现图像识别、压缩等功能。硬件工程师则负责设计摄像头电路,包括传感器、信号处理、电源管理等。两者在项目中的分工不同,但共同为产品提供高性能、低功耗的解决方案。
总之,FPGA工程师与硬件工程师在个人成长方面存在诸多区别。了解这些区别有助于从事相关职业的人员明确自己的发展方向,提高自身竞争力。在未来的发展中,FPGA工程师与硬件工程师需要不断学习、创新,为我国电子技术领域的发展贡献力量。
猜你喜欢:猎头合作网站